Supplies (Affiliate links used)
- Paper: I used mulberry paper to give the robes a fabric feel but you can use origami or scrapbook paper. I suggest using acid-free paper as these cards will probably be a keept as keepsakes.
- Adhesive
- Ribbon 1/4″ satin and 1/2″ grosgrain (or whatever you have handy. Cardstock strips will also work.
- Brads: Mini and decorative (or a metal button can be used as a medal)
- Mini tassels (these are larger than what I used but you can easily make tassels from embroidery floss.
- Embroidery floss or craft thread
- Congratulations stamp
- Ink and embossing powder
- Cardstock (I used heavy weight purple and gold metallic card)
